Celmac was founded by the current CEO Wayne McIntyre in 1987 as a lamination film supplier. Venturing into hardware with lamination machines, The company entered the wide format printer space in 2000 with Nur Macroprinters. Today, Celmac is a leading supplier of HP, Epson, Digitech, DimenseDG , Kala, Resolute and other top brands.

One of the larger exhibitors at PacPrint 2025 is Konica Minolta. Founded in 1873, as a photographic materials supplier, later adding copiers; in 2003 Konica merged with Minolta, who had been making copiers since the 1960s, and exited cameras altogether in 2006.

The CDP (formerly the Carbon Disclosure Project) is an international non-profit organisation based in the United Kingdom, Japan, India, China, Germany, Brazil and the United States that helps companies, cities, states, regions and public authorities disclose their environmental impact.
